The life of Caroline Slezak-Kawa — a.k.a. Care Failure of Die Mannequin — will be celebrated with Failurefest, a one-night event at Toronto's Bovine Sex Club on May 2.

ACIIDZ, Fine Motor Control and Blackout Orchestra lead the bill, with a Die Mannequin supergroup featuring Ian D'Sa of Billy Talent on guitar also on deck. Kali-Ann Butala from Bad Waitress and Emily Bones and Valerie Knox of the Anti-Queens will also add guest vocals throughout the sets. The festival will be hosted by Leora CW of Bloody Mannequins and Mike Austin of Deepsix. 

All ticket proceeds will be donated to Toronto non-profit Sistering, where Slezak-Kawa volunteered over the years. Advance tickets for Failurefest will be released tonight (April 19) at 7 p.m.

Slezak-Kawa died last March. She was 36 years old.
